Abstract

The invention discloses a sealing rubber strip material, which comprises the following ingredients in parts by mass: 30 to 45 parts of chemigum (N230S), 10 to 20 parts of chemigum (N250S/1846), 15 to 25 parts of modified neoprene, 1 to 3 parts of anti-aging agents, 1 to 3 parts of accelerants, 5 to 10 parts of dioctyl phthalate, 10 to 20 parts of carbon black, 5 to 15 parts of white carbon black, 2 to 3 parts of microcrystalline wax, 2 to 3 parts of vulcanizing agents and 0.5 to 2 parts of ultraviolet absorbents. The sealing rubber strip material has the characteristics of oil resistance, weather resistance, strong tensile strength, ozone resistance, abrasion resistance and the like.

Background technology
The joint strip of joint strip, particularly railway locomotive, wind-powered electricity generation head bearing, it is very high to technical requirements such as oil-proofness, weathering resistance, tensile strength, resistance to ozone and abrasion; Current commercially available prod, after short duration uses, just there will be tensile strength deficiency, carries out ozone test and easily produce be full of cracks, weather resistance test and equally also can produce crack performance.

The object of the invention to solve the technical problems realizes by the following technical solutions.According to the sealing strip material that the present invention proposes, comprise each component of following mass parts,
Paracril N230S 30 ~ 45;
Paracril N250S/1846 10 ~ 20;
Modification N-Serve rubber 15 ~ 25;
Anti-aging agent 1 ~ 3;
Promotor 1 ~ 3;
Dibutyl ester 5 ~ 10;
Carbon black 10 ~ 20;
White carbon black 5 ~ 15;
Microcrystalline Wax 2 ~ 3;
Vulcanizing agent 2 ~ 3;
UV light absorber 0.5 ~ 2.
Further, aforesaid sealing strip material, described modification N-Serve rubber is MCS-N.
Further, aforesaid sealing strip material, described anti-aging agent is RD, and promotor is TAIC; Promotor is TAIC is iso-cyanuric acid triallyl ester.
Further, aforesaid sealing strip material, described vulcanizing agent is DCP; Described vulcanizing agent is DCP is dicumyl peroxide.
Further, aforesaid sealing strip material, described UV light absorber is UV326.
By technique scheme, sealing strip material of the present invention at least has following advantages:
Sealing strip material of the present invention, adds modification N-Serve rubber, adopts chloroprene rubber as main material, toxic substance halogen-containing in material is carried out process modification, good weatherability, thus improves the weather resistance of material of the present invention.
Further described modification N-Serve rubber is that N-Serve rubber adds HBS xylogen or calcium lignin sulphonate or maize straw alkali lignin or Indulin alkali lignin and tensio-active agent and is fully uniformly mixed under the temperature condition of 95 DEG C ~ 100 DEG C, leaves standstill after 5 ~ 10 minutes.Modification N-Serve rubber quality ratio of the present invention is the mass ratio of 80% ~ 90%, HBS xylogen or calcium lignin sulphonate or maize straw alkali lignin or Indulin alkali lignin is 8% ~ 18%, and surfactant qualities ratio is 2%.
Paracril N230S, improves the oil resistance of material of the present invention; Same paracril 1846/N250S can make material of the present invention greatly improve oil-proofness and low temperature resistant performance.
